Online & Distance Learning at Cape Cod Community College
Many students take online classes at Cape Cod Community College. Among 3,260 students, 692 (21%) studied exclusively online and 1,070 (33%) took at least some classes online.

Top-Paying Careers for Environmental Control Technology Graduates
Graduates of the Environmental Control Technology program at Cape Cod Community College go on to a range of careers. Here are the highest-paying careers for Environmental Control Technology graduates,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Engineering Technologists and Technicians, Except Drafters, All Other | $121,642 |
| Photonics Technicians | $106,964 |
| Environmental Engineering Technologists and Technicians | $77,085 |
|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anics and Installers | $66,308 |
| Non-Destructive Testing Specialists | $57,631 |
| Water and Wastewater Treatment Plant and System Operators | $48,896 |
| Hazardous Materials Removal Workers | $31,832 |
